June 23-25: Allied Media Conference, Bowling Green, OH

Posted on May 18, 2006

The 2006 Allied Media Conference from June 23 to June 25th will bring together some of the most innovative and visionary culture producers, media workers, artists and activists. Arts Engine is excited to join the AMC once again this year with a "Making The Most Of Your Event" workshop and the Ohio Premiere of the Sixth Annual Media That Matters Film Festival.

Making the Most of Your Event: Outreach and Evaluation Tips
presented by Wendy Cohen
A successful event is not just about numbers. How do you evaluate if your event made an imact? How can you ensure that attendees become engaged members of your community? The workshop facilitator will take you through the ropes of promotion, evaluation, outreach and long term community building.

Sixth Annual Media That Matters Film Festival Screening
16 inspiring short films from our newest collection launching June 1 2006.
